Know your bike inside out

The bicycle is probably one of the oldest forms of mechanized transportation used by man. It’s simple yet intricate structure has not undergone any radical change or transformation but is being steadily upgraded and diversified with technological advancement.

Commonly referred to as a bike, it is basically a vehicle powered by mechanical energy. The Penny-farthing is probably the oldest known kind of bicycle which has evolved over the years into something more sophisticated such as the mountain bike. A bike is made up of several assembled parts which facilitate its smooth functioning.

Parts of a bike:

  1. Chassis or frame: As the skeleton is to the human body, so is the frame to a bike. The frame is a network of tubes which support and integrate the exterior parts of the bike. Bike frames that are lightweight yet sturdy provide optimized usability. The seat tube upholds the saddle or seat of the bike. Check your present chassis for any fractures or damage and make sure you replace it immediately to ensure smooth functioning.

  2. Drive train: The drive train consists of the crank arms, pedals, chain rings and bracket which help the wheels to rotate when force is applied. We come across difficulty in cycling when the chain slips much too often. You must consider rectifying this for your own safety purposes. In more advanced versions of bikes, several gears are also present. Shifting gears allow the cyclist to maintain the same pace at which he is pedaling throughout, irrespective of the nature of his track or path.

  3. Handle bars: The handlebar is the navigating tool of the bike. The brakes are for the front and rear wheel are attached to the handle bars. Simple bikes have upright handle bars whereas racing bikes or mountain bikes have sleek, dropped handle bars.

  4. Suspension: Suspension is synonymous with shock absorption. This provides a smooth and comfortable ride to the biker. It also protects the other parts of the bike from damage due to bad road conditions.

  5. Wheels: Bike wheels consist of a metal hub. There is a rim around this hub through which the spokes of the wheel pass. The outer covering consists of a rubber tube and tire.

Apart from the above mentioned, mud guards, rear view mirrors, lights, backpack hydration system and rear or front bike racks are used to further accessorize a bike for practical purposes. Bikes can be broadly categorized as road bikes, mountain bikes and hybrid bikes.
